Anaerobic Connector Market - Global Forecast 2026-2032

The Anaerobic Connector Market size was estimated at USD 1.27 billion in 2025 and expected to reach USD 1.34 billion in 2026, at a CAGR of 5.08% to reach USD 1.79 billion by 2032.

Setting the Stage for Unparalleled Performance and Reliability in Anaerobic Connection Solutions Across Critical Infrastructure and Industrial Applications

Anaerobic connectors play a pivotal role in ensuring leak-free junctions within high-precision fluid transfer systems. By employing chemical reactions in oxygen-deprived environments, these connectors form robust seals that resist vibration, temperature fluctuations, and corrosive media. As industries demand higher levels of integrity in critical processes, the reliability of anaerobic connection technology emerges as a cornerstone of operational excellence.

Across sectors such as chemical processing, oil and gas, water treatment, and marine applications, the adoption of anaerobic connectors has accelerated in response to stringent safety regulations and performance standards. Their ability to maintain long-term sealing integrity under extreme conditions reduces maintenance downtime and mitigates the risk of hazardous leaks. Consequently, organizations prioritize solutions that not only withstand harsh environments but also integrate seamlessly with advanced instrumentation and automated systems.

Drawing Actionable Insights from Multifaceted Segmentation That Define Sales Material Industry Application and Connector Type Trends Shaping Market Dynamics

Analysis based on sales channel reveals that direct engagement through end user direct and original equipment manufacturer relationships continues to capture priority for critical projects, where bespoke connector specifications and engineering support are paramount. At the same time, distribution across international distributors and regional partners ensures a broad footprint that addresses mid-tier demand, while online availability via ecommerce platforms and manufacturer websites unlocks rapid procurement for standard configurations.

Material segmentation underscores the balance between traditional and advanced substrates. Fiber reinforced and polymer composites deliver weight reduction and chemical resistance, whereas stainless steel options in Grade 304 and Grade 316 maintain legacy performance in corrosive environments. Alloy and carbon steel variants offer a cost-effective compromise for general-purpose applications, while thermoplastic solutions in HDPE and PVC extend lifecycle benefits within aggressive chemical service.

End use industry distinctions further refine opportunity assessments. Within basic and specialty chemicals, demand centers on high-purity connectors resistant to aggressive media, and marine usage divides between commercial shipping and defense applications with stringent certification requirements. In oil and gas, upstream, midstream, and downstream operations each impose unique temperature and pressure constraints, and water treatment installations differentiate between industrial and municipal specifications. Connector type analysis reveals that compression ferrule assemblies, whether double or single ferrule, dominate high-pressure tubing, flanged designs-slip on or weld neck-serve bulk piping interconnects, dry break and wet break quick connect solutions enable safe line changes, and threaded BSP or NPT configurations remain ubiquitous across maintenance-oriented installations. Application segmentation highlights that pipelines transporting chemicals, oil, or water demand specialized sealants, pumps-centrifugal or positive displacement-require precision porting, storage tanks span fixed or mobile configurations, and valves-whether ball, check, or gate-depend on connector interfaces that align with their torque and pressure ratings.

Revealing Distinct Regional Developments Across Americas Europe Middle East Africa and Asia Pacific That Drive Demand and Investment in Anaerobic Connection Systems

Regional dynamics exhibit pronounced variation across the Americas, where robust energy infrastructure investments and water treatment expansions drive sustained uptake of anaerobic connectors. Producers in North America have leveraged established supply networks to streamline delivery, while Latin American markets emphasize resilience in downstream oil and gas operations.

In Europe Middle East and Africa, Mediterranean chemical hubs and North Sea offshore projects stimulate demand for high-grade stainless steel solutions, and defense-oriented marine applications in the Gulf region propel investments in dry-break quick-connect assemblies. Localized regulatory frameworks and environmental mandates further shape connector design and certification pathways.

Across Asia-Pacific, rapid industrialization and infrastructure development elevate requirements for versatile connector portfolios. Chemical processing facilities in Southeast Asia prioritize composite and thermoplastic alternatives to address aggressive corrosive challenges, while storage and pipeline expansions in Australia and China underscore the importance of modular connector systems that facilitate phased capacity growth.
